19th century Comprising thirty-two prints: twenty-three sheets attributed to Hiroshige II or III, (incomplete) from the series Nihon Meisho (Famous Places in Japan), depicting well known sites and landmarks in Harima, Kyoto, Omi, Izumi, Kii, Tango, Settsu, Kochi, Yamato and others, chuban, no censor or publisher's seal, unsigned; two sheets by Hiroshige I, Nihon Fujizukushi Toto Edobashi and Ishiyama Shugetsu from the Omi Hakkei series; a yakusha-e of Bando Mitsugoro by Toyokuni III; a bijin-ga by Ichigyokusai Kunitaka; and another actor print of Segawa Kikunojo by Kuniyoshi, variously signed and published; and four facsimile prints after Hiroshige. The smallest 18cm x 25cm (7in x 9¾in), the largest 38.5cm x 26.2cm (15 1/8in x 10¼in). (32).
